У меня есть сигнал с относительно высокой частотой, и я хочу подробно взглянуть на начало записанного сигнала и конца. Как сигнал длится 1 час, и я хочу первые 10 секунд, а последние 10 секунд увеличились (на оси x) и среднюю часть «Нормальный». < /P>
i Уже нашел этот метод < /p>
axs.set_yscale('function', functions=(forward, inverse))
, который должен быть в состоянии определить пользовательскую масштаб, но я не могу понять, как это работает, и я не могу найти много документации по этому методу.
Я не могу поделиться реальными данными, но данные выглядят очень похоже на пазух, поэтому можно использовать этот график, чтобы визуализировать его: < /p>
fig, axs = plt.subplots()
x = np.arange(0, 1000 * np.pi, 0.1)
y = 2 * np.sin(x) + 3
axs.plot(x, y)
Подробнее здесь: https://stackoverflow.com/questions/791 ... ng-and-end
Matplotlib увеличен в оси x в начале и конец ⇐ Python
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Линия тренда matplotlib с временными метками по оси X, плавает по оси Y
Anonymous » » в форуме Python - 0 Ответы
- 253 Просмотры
-
Последнее сообщение Anonymous
-